Fox News is looking for an organized, motivated, curious Assignment Editor with strong logistical and editorial skills to join our assignment desk team in the Washington D.C Bureau. The Assignment Editor works with a team of people to coordinate daily news coverage, which includes moving crews, adjusting to cover breaking news and responding to cover a consistent flow of events at the Capitol, White House, Pentagon, State Department and other venues in DC. The Assignment Editor also prioritizes incoming editorial & logistical information and ensures it is clearly communicated to those who need it. Proactively seeking out additional information and pitching stories is critical to success in this position. A natural curiosity of news is a must.
A SNAPSHOT OF YOUR RESPONSIBILITIES
• Assigns, moves, and adjusts crew coverage to keep the network competitive at all times
• Works with beat producers in planning and adjusting coverage as news breaks
• Monitors wires, social media and other broadcast networks for news developments
• Reaches out to agencies, government departments, and FOX personnel to gather and confirm information
• Drafts and distributes information to field, show and network personnel
• Organizes and develops creative plans to maximize limited resources
• Coordinates with field, technical and satellite desk personnel to make sure incoming feeds between DC and NY are prioritized to provide the most competitive coverage
• Trains and works on satellite desk when needed

WHAT YOU WILL NEED
• 3 years of experience in a local or national newsroom
• Strong logistical and editorial skills with knowledge of national and international politics
• Familiarity with the various D.C. government agencies
• Keen understanding of how to gather news LIVE in the Washington, D.C. area and familiarity with satellite trucks, Live U technology, AVOC and various fiber drops
• Knowledge of network pool operations at the desk level with an emphasis on understanding the unilateral benefit
• Being a self-starter who can work autonomously, as well as a team player
• Ability to work in a fast-paced environment, multitask, and prioritize on a daily basis, and especially in breaking news situations
